I finally got around to trying an idea I had been toying with for this recipe. I wanted it to taste more authentic, so I subbed sesame oil for the olive oil and chicken broth for the orange juice. It turned out FABULOUS!!! Seriously, it tasted like something that you would get at your favorite Chinese take out place. With those two simple substitutions, it went from being a well liked dinner to being a favorite dinner!   
¾ cup Orange  Juice   Chicken Broth                   
1/3 cup  Honey                         
¼ cup  Soy  Sauce (make sure it's GF)
1 tsp. Garlic  Powder
½ tsp. Pepper
4 boneless Skinless Chicken Breasts                 
 1 1/2 Tbs. Olive Oil  Sesame Oil
1 Tbs. Corn  Starch              
 1 cup Cashews             
4 green onion
1 lg, carrot  sliced                         
1 celery stalk, sliced
Combine
 and set  aside the OJ  Chicken Broth, Honey, Soy Sauce, Corn Starch, Garlic Powder, 
Pepper.  In a large pan sauté the chicken.  In a separate pan cook olive
 oil  sesame oil,  green onions, carrot, and celery until  softened.  Add veggies, 
sauce, cashews to chicken and heat through.
